`

mysql 编码转换

阅读更多

想获得UTF-8编码的数据,但MySQL表的编码是GBK的

很多人在处理这个问题时,是先查询MySQL获得原始数据,然后使用iconv或者mb_convert_encoding把编码从GBK转换成UTF-8,其实只要在查询前SET NAMES ‘utf8’即可,不明真相的MySQL使用者们往往认为GBK编码的表在查询时只能SET NAMES ‘gbk’,这实在是一大谬误。

分享到:
评论

相关推荐

    多功能编码转换工具_多功能编码转换_

    多功能编码转换器,可用于mysql,bd2,mssql,access

    数据库编码转换程序

    数据库编码转换程序

    Mysql转换为Access数据库软件

    Convert Mysql to Access - 数据库转换工具,实现Mysql转换为Access数据库免费版,在使用过程中,一定要选择正确mysql的编码,要不会出现乱码。

    MySQL编码不一致可能引起的一些问题

    MySQL 存储过程中, 表和数据的编码与数据库和存储过程默认的编码不同则可能出现 sql 不会使用索引的情况, 因为 MySQL 会对条件列的数据做相应的编码转换, 比如以下, 表数据为 latin1, MySQL 解析器会做一些转换: ...

    MySQL GBK→UTF-8编码转换

    Convertz——文本编码转换工具,molyx上介绍的,我采用的。其实这类工具很多。 二理论: MySQL从4.1版本开始内部存储字符集支持了UTF-8,这个我也是这几天才看到的。因为升级论坛过程中,服务器数据库环境为4.0.26...

    不乱码批量修改mysql数据库、表、字段编码(gbk到utf8php脚本)

    批量修改mysql数据库、表、字段编码(gbk到utf8php脚本) 可以把整个数据库、表、字段编码全部从gbk_chinese_ci 到 utf8_general_ci 转换,不会乱码哦 狂拽吊炸天!!!

    MD5转换小工具

    MD5转换小工具

    文本文件编码转换工具 gbk utf8 gb2312

    如此一来整站编码就都是国际能用的utf8编码了.通用性现在做到最好了. 问题也是有的,在此环境下涉及到数据库运行的文件都必须是 utf8编码.这样一来就出现了不兼容,因为在国内大家都是以GBK gb2312编的码 包括 17...

    查看修改mysql编码方式让它支持中文(gbk或者utf8)

    MySQL的默认编码是Latin1,不支持中文,要支持中文需要把数据库的默认编码修改为gbk或者utf8。 1、需要以root用户身份登陆才可以查看数据库编码方式(以root用户身份登陆的命令为:>mysql -u root –p,之后两次输入...

    MYSQL数据库便民转换

    本程序可以实现latin1<->gbk,gbk<->utf8,gbk<->big5,的编码的相互转换,程序可以进行多次转换即可以实现latin1->gbk->utf8等的转换,但是不能跳跃转换(例:latin1不能直接转换成utf8)

    将关系型数据库MySQL存储数据转换为XML文件的实现

    随之计算机技术和网络技术的不断发展,对网络传输数据的有趣...同时,实现过程中使用接口进行处理,在避免重复编码的基础上也部分屏蔽了底层的转换细节。所有本文所提出的数据转换实现方法具有一定的应用价值和扩展价值

    mysql修改数据库编码(数据库字符集)和表的字符编码的方法

    mysql将表的字符编码转换成utf-8 代码如下:alter table tb_anniversary convert to character set utf8; 修改数据库mysql字符编码为UTF8 步骤1:查看当前的字符编码方法 代码如下:mysql> show variables like’...

    ZipToAddress:将 API 日本邮政编码转换为地址

    将邮政编码转换为地址 api 环境 Python(3.4.1) 烧瓶 SQLAlchemy 准备 Python 模块 pip install -r requirements.txt 数据库准备 下载包含zip_address信息SQL文件。 wget ...

    MySQL数据库字符集转换及升级全教程

    MySQL 4.1开始把多国语言字符集分的更加详细,所以导致数据库迁移,或则dz论坛升级到4.0后(dz4.0开始使用gbk或utf-8编码)出现乱码问题。本文分析了出现乱码的原因,介绍了MySQL数据库字符集转换及升级的方法。

    报表开发工具中mysql数据库连接编码转化失效解决方案

    在报表开发工具FineReport中,mysql数据库连接通过数据连接编码转换进行编码的转换,在通过报表录入往数据库中录入中文数据的时候,总是出现乱码,根据自己的平时的操作,在本文中分享相关的解决方案。

    mysql4数据库转移到mysql5

    mysql4数据库转移到mysql5,首先将文件的编码转换为utf-8 如果使用editplus,打开文件,

    MySQL绿色版设置编码以及1067错误详解

    查看MySQL编码 SHOW VARIABLES LIKE 'char%'; 因为当初安装时指定了字符集为UTF8,所以所有的编码都是UTF8。 character_set_client:你发送的数据必须与client指定的编码一致!!!服务器会使用该编码来解读客户端...

    MYSQL网络数据库远程服务易语言源码

    4.编码转换目前只支持两种GBK,UTF8,其他可自行添加!点评:易语言MYSQL网络数据库远程服务源码例程程序结合易语言扩展界面支持库,实现MYSQL数据库的网络远程应用并分页显示的功能。易语言例程还使用到易语言Mysql...

    php版mysql大数据库备份和恢复工具

    4.虽然程序目前支持GBK、BIG5、UTF8之间的编码转换,但这种转换不是安全的.首先你的目标导入服务器要支持iconv,即在导入时如果"编码转换功能"提示为支持,则可以使用此功能.反之则不可以.其次,转换时的数据必须是"干净...

Global site tag (gtag.js) - Google Analytics